ID 1.14.14.40 DE phenylalanine N-monooxygenase. AN CYP79A2. AN CYP79D16. AN phenylalanine N-hydroxylase. CA L-phenylalanine + 2 reduced [NADPH--hemoprotein reductase] + 2 O2 = (E)- CA phenylacetaldehyde oxime + 2 oxidized [NADPH--hemoprotein reductase] + CA CO2 + 3 H2O + 2 H(+). CC -!- This enzyme, found in plants, catalyzes two successive CC N-hydroxylations of L-phenylalanine, a committed step in the CC biosynthesis of benzylglucosinolate and the cyanogenic glucosides CC (R)-prunasin and (R)-amygdalin. CC -!- The product of the two hydroxylations, N,N-dihydroxy-L-phenylalanine, CC is labile and undergoes dehydration followed by decarboxylation, CC producing an oxime. CC -!- It is still not known whether the decarboxylation is spontaneous or CC catalyzed by the enzyme. CC -!- Formerly EC 1.14.13.124 and EC 1.14.13.n1.
